The Longest Off-Road Race in the United States
This year’s TSCO “Vegas to Reno” – which is certifiably the Longest Off-Road Race in the United States at 457.5 miles, is already creating excitement among the off-road racing community. Casey Folks, Director of the Best in the Desert series, said, “2008 has already been a huge growth year for Best In The Desert off road desert racing in terms of participants. We are excited that the TSCO “Vegas to Reno” event, our flagship race, will carry on that momentum. Not only is this going to be a big event but it’s also the 12th running of TSCO “Vegas to Reno.” This race is open to all Best In The Desert classes – cars, trucks, UTVs, quads and motorcycles. And, with the ongoing changes in off-road racing, we expect over 300 entries.” Folks worked closely with the BLM to set up a course that avoids endangered species, and does not harm the environment. The course just changed to a start area 6.5 miles north of the town of Beatty, Nevada, with all classes off on Friday, August 22nd. Originally part of the Bullfrog Mining District, today Beatty serves as an important
gateway to Death Valley, and is 115 miles from Las Vegas. The course traverses a part of the legendary Pony Express Trail made famous 148 years ago, and finishes up east of Reno, Nevada.
The TSCO “Vegas to Reno” race takes racers from the high desert floor at 2,500 feet elevation to mountainous heights of over 9,000 feet, forcing competitors to adjust to the changing pressures, and endure extreme hot and cold temperature variations. This course features some of the toughest, and most varied terrain in the world. On the dry lakebed portions of the route speeds over 100 MPH are typical. Racers
must fight their way through narrow canyons, boulder lined paths, and deep silt beds.

Round five of the Championship Off Road Racing season brought some of the best racing yet as the series’ top drivers battled for every position on the track. On a day that had hotly contested races in both the Pro 2 and Pro 4 classes, the Pro 4 Jason Baldwin Memorial Cup Pro 4 race saw a continuation of the rivalry between existing champion Carl Renezeder and Monster Energy Drink/Forest County Potawatomi star Johnny Greaves.
In Pro 2, Makita/Rockstar Energy Drink driver Todd LeDuc turned back challenges from class leader Rockstar Energy Drink/Menzies Motorsports’s #21 Rob MacCachren and Red Bull/Bosch Power Tools’s Ricky Johnson to take his first win of the season. While the V8 trucks saw lots of big crashes and exciting lead changes, Traxxas/ Potawatomi Pro Lite pilot Jeff Kincaid took a 15 second lead going into the mandatory caution flag that was reduced to just three seconds as he and second place finisher Marty Hart separated themselves from the field.
